The traditional medical-psychiatric view of "mental illness."

In the 1700-1800s, physicians did not understand the "body-mind" or "body-brain" connection. Most times a person was declared "insane"when, in fact, they had a brain infection such as meningitis. Sadly, most of these people suffered and died while in county homes or state insane asylums.

Finally, with the discovery of bacteria and viruses, more people received treatment for the medical problems that affect the brain and can cause "insanity".

Medical scientists now believe many forms of "mental illness" are caused by chemical imbalances in the brain. For example, many types of depression can be treated if the serotonin levels in the brain are more balanced.

Some "mental illnesses" are not treatable at this time. What has been labeled "Anti-social Personality" disorder is considered untreatable as are most illnesses that include the lack of a moral conscience.

Is dyslexia a mental disorder?

Dyslexia is a learning difference that affects a person's ability to read, write, and spell. It is not considered a mental disorder but rather a neurological condition that impacts how the brain processes language.

Are phobias a mental disorder or a pshychological disorder?

According to the Diagnostic and Statistical Manual of Mental Disorders, phobias are considered to be sub-types of anxiety disorder (psychiatric disorder).
